Mbeki meets Mugabe - again

Posted 7th July 2008 at 02:25 PM by NewsTracker (Tracking the News)
HARARE - South African President Thabo Mbeki met Zimbabwean President Robert Mugabe on Saturday to try to help end a political crisis after a violent election that extended Mugabe's 28-year rule.

The main opposition party, the Movement for Democratic Change (MDC), said its leader Morgan Tsvangirai had declined to meet Mbeki, who has tried to mediate between the two sides.

Tsvangirai and his MDC have criticised Mbeki's mediation efforts, accusing him of siding with Mugabe...

'Can I give you some Harare luggage for your US dollars?'

Posted 7th July 2008 at 02:10 PM by NewsTracker (Tracking the News)
HARARE , 4 July 2008 (IRIN) - The flower seller booths on Unity Square in the Zimbabwean capital, Harare, are now the haunt of money changers, because this is one of the few commercial activities in the country still experiencing any kind of growth.

Cosmos, 24, fell into the business a few years ago while working at a bar, where he changed some local money for foreign tourists who had US dollars, or "green leaf" as he calls it. The roughly US$150 a month he makes in profit...
